Blender GIS / ทำตามคลิป

Thitipong Samranvarnich
4 min readMar 14, 2021

--

ทำตาม >> Blender GIS , from Youtube

version ที่ใช้ คือ 2.91.0

Goto https://github.com/domlysz/BlenderGIS

แล้ว ดาวน์โหลด ทั้งหมดไปที่เครื่องเราเอง

สมมุติ Save ไว้ที่ Folder Downloads\

แล้วเข้า Blender เมนู Edit > Preference … แล้วเลือก Add on Session

แล้วกด Install แล้วหาไฟล์ที่เราโหลดมา

เลือก ไฟล์ zip ที่โหลดมา

จะเห็นรายการโชว์ที่หน้า Add On

ให้เช็คถูกแล้วแก้คอนฟิกโดยคลิกที่ ลูกศร หน้า ชื่อ Plugin , ระบุFolder ที่จะเก็บแคช ในที่นี้เราสร้าง folder สำหรับ cache ไว้ที่ c:\_blender_gis_cache ซึ่งเราสร้างไว้ก่อนแล้ว เพื่อให้ ง่ายในการ ลบ cache

แล้วปิด preference เลย

จะมีเมนู GIS ขึ้นมาใหม่

ควรปิด Blender แล้วเปิดใหม่อีกครั้ง เพื่อให้ Blender บันทึกว่า มีการเปิดใช้ Add On นี้ ไม่เช่นนั้น หากโปรแกรมปิดโดยไม่คาดหมาย เราจะต้องทำขั้นตอนข้างบนนั้นใหม่หมด อีกครั้ง

ให้คลิกเพื่อ

จะเห็นว่า เรา โหลด GIS ได้หลายแบบเช่น โหลด Shape File (*.shp ) แต่เราจะไม่ใช้ในกรณีนี้

ตัวอย่าง การ โหลด Shape File จะเป็นแบบนี้ (ไม่มีตัวอย่างนะครับ ลองค้นจากเน็ตดูนะครับ)

ถ้า import แบบ ระบุให้แยก object จะได้ ดังนี้

จะเห็นชื่อ เป็นภาษาท้องถิ่นเพราะเราเลือก name_local

ดึงข้อมูลจาก Web geodata

ที่เราจะใช้คือ ดึงมาจาก Web geodata > basemap

เมื่อเลือกแล้ว จะมีให้เลือก ว่า เป็น Google และ ให้เลือกว่า แบบ จากดาวเทียมหรือ แผนที่ปกติ มีให้เลือกหลายแบบ ดังนี้

แต่เรา จะเลือก แบบ Google > Satellite นะครับ

ผลก็จะตามนี้ ครับ

แล้วซูมเข้ามากๆ เพื่อจะให้เห็นเพียง ส่วนย่อยๆ ข้อมูลจะได้ไม่โหลดมากเกินไป

เท่าที่สังเกตุ จะเป็น raster และมีการดึงข้อมูล ภาพ bitmap ทุกๆครั้งที่มีการ ย่อขยาย วิว ให้ซูมเข้าไปลึกๆ

กด E เพื่อ Export จะได้ รูปเพื่อนำไปประมวลผลต่อได้

จะทำการปรับมุมกล้องได้แล้ว

ให้นำเข้าข้อมูล ชั้นความสูงด้วยคำสั่ง

Gis > Web geodata > …. (SRTM) จะได้ ข้อมูลดังนี้

เลือกค่า server แบบที่เขากำหนดมาแบบ default แล้วกด OK

จะเห็นว่ามีข้อมูล DEM หรือชั้นความสูง ขึ้นมาให้เห็น

และ ที่แผนที่ จะมีการปรับปรุงให้มีการเห็นข้อมูลสูงขึ้น จะเห็นรอยหยัก

ถ้า เป็นพื้นที่สูง เช่นบางจังหวัด เช่นโคราช อาจเห็นชั้นความสูงชัดเจนกว่านี้เช่น

แล้ว Get OSM จาก เมนู GIS

ข้อมูลของเมืองนอก จะมีข้อมูล ตึกสูงและอาคารด้วย แต่ของไทย เท่าที่เห็น ยังไม่มีเลย

ถ้าแถบ อเมริกา ข้อมูลจะเยอะมาก มีรวมทั้งข้อมูลตึกด้วย
ซึ่งจะใช้เวลา นานมาก และเน็ตคงต้องแรง ต้องเลือกพื้นที่น้อยๆไว้ ดังรูป

ส่วนการจะ Render ได้ เราต้อง ปรับมุมกล้องก่อน ซึ่งจะกล่าวถึง ในภายหลัง

--

--